.sa-meta.svelte-1qk1azd{margin:1rem 0 0;font-family:var(--font-mono);font-size:var(--type-tiny);letter-spacing:.02em;color:var(--text-meta)}.sa-modules.svelte-1qk1azd{display:flex;flex-direction:column;gap:3.5rem}.sa-module-head.svelte-1qk1azd{margin-bottom:1rem}.sa-module-mark.svelte-1qk1azd{margin:0 0 .4rem;font-family:var(--font-mono);font-size:var(--type-tiny);letter-spacing:.06em;text-transform:uppercase;color:var(--text-meta)}.sa-module-title.svelte-1qk1azd{margin:0 0 .35rem;font-family:var(--font-serif);font-weight:600;font-size:var(--type-h3);letter-spacing:var(--type-h3-track);color:var(--text-primary)}.sa-module-purpose.svelte-1qk1azd{margin:0;max-width:44rem;font-family:var(--font-sans);font-size:var(--type-small);line-height:1.55;color:var(--text-secondary)}.sa-module-dl.svelte-1qk1azd{display:inline-block;margin-top:.85rem;font-family:var(--font-mono);font-size:var(--type-tiny);letter-spacing:.02em;text-decoration:none;color:var(--on-pastel);transition:color .16s ease}.sa-module-dl.svelte-1qk1azd:hover{color:var(--pink-base)}.sa-foot.svelte-1qk1azd{margin:3rem 0 0;font-family:var(--font-sans);font-size:var(--type-small);color:var(--text-secondary)}
